Output 81fa7ccc045dfea21633d442d045db7b8a03902cc26e4e7e5e50541d3fc01525:0

value
9895740
script pubkey
OP_0 OP_PUSHBYTES_20 b419ad0a4631aaa7c7ebe9ece005c314168826a4
address
bc1qksv66zjxxx4203lta8kwqpwrzstgsf4y7js7vk
transaction
81fa7ccc045dfea21633d442d045db7b8a03902cc26e4e7e5e50541d3fc01525
confirmations
250353
spent
true